Mumbai residential societies take to MYBYK bike-sharing service to ensure wellbeing and sustainability

Posted on July 29, 2021 By

Mumbai, Maharashtra [India], July 29: In an endeavour to adopt sustainability and ensure their wellbeing, residents of Mumbai’s societies in Lokhandwala, Oshiwara, Versova and Andheri are adopting MYBYK’s bicycle-sharing service. MYBYK sets up an automated bicycle hub in the townships, and people can get bicycles on rent through the MYBYK mobile app. One can also subscribe to MYBYK bicycles under hourly, weekly, monthly or long-term plans.

The development comes amid COVID-19 that has made people conscious of their choices with respect to what they buy, consume or use. The pandemic has also heralded a shift towards more sustainable and greener lifestyle choices, including sustainable means to commute.

While Mumbai is growing rapidly, traffic, congestion, gridlock and pollution are becoming key concerns. This development is part of Mumbaikars’ endeavour to begin small but incremental lifestyle changes towards making the city more sustainable and ensure their wellness.

One of the early adopters is the Serenity Complex in the Oshiwara area. MYBYK is India’s largest and most successful premium bicycle-sharing service aimed at encouraging the use of bicycles and public transport as a sustainable mobility solution. It was founded in 2014 by Arjit Soni, a chartered accountant. The idea was born out of his struggles connecting the first and last mile while using Mumbai locals. MYBYK has pioneered the concept of shared mobility in an endeavour to make an outdoor experience more lively, diverse, and healthy and usher in a ‘green’ future for generations to come.

As of date, the company boasts of a total fleet size of 6000+ cycles spread across Ahmedabad, Mumbai, Udaipur & Rajkot. Some of its prominent projects include Ahmedabad Smart City PBS, Mumbai Metro Bicycle Feeder Service, Reliance Industries Limited (Jamnagar Refinery), ISRO (SAC Campus).
